Not sure if you’re running off of a generator or you hooked to a landline. If you’re running the generator you might try turning off your converter, that might give you the extra power you need to run your air conditioner.
If it is leaking at the cap on the roof you might want to try taping that seam on the roof with Eternal Bond R V rubber roof tape.
Ive used it and its worked well.
